Fix missing codecov configuration (#487)

This commit is contained in:
takanuva15 2025-07-26 04:08:43 -04:00 committed by Jakub Chrzanowski
parent 2430382824
commit a6be38b93c
4 changed files with 13 additions and 0 deletions

View File

@ -15,6 +15,7 @@
- [ ] Set the [Plugin Signing](https://plugins.jetbrains.com/docs/intellij/plugin-signing.html?from=IJPluginTemplate) related [secrets](https://github.com/JetBrains/intellij-platform-plugin-template#environment-variables). - [ ] Set the [Plugin Signing](https://plugins.jetbrains.com/docs/intellij/plugin-signing.html?from=IJPluginTemplate) related [secrets](https://github.com/JetBrains/intellij-platform-plugin-template#environment-variables).
- [ ] Set the [Deployment Token](https://plugins.jetbrains.com/docs/marketplace/plugin-upload.html?from=IJPluginTemplate). - [ ] Set the [Deployment Token](https://plugins.jetbrains.com/docs/marketplace/plugin-upload.html?from=IJPluginTemplate).
- [ ] Click the <kbd>Watch</kbd> button on the top of the [IntelliJ Platform Plugin Template][template] to be notified about releases containing new features and fixes. - [ ] Click the <kbd>Watch</kbd> button on the top of the [IntelliJ Platform Plugin Template][template] to be notified about releases containing new features and fixes.
- [ ] Configure the [CODECOV_TOKEN](https://docs.codecov.com/docs/quick-start) secret for automated test coverage reports on PRs
<!-- Plugin description --> <!-- Plugin description -->
This Fancy IntelliJ Platform Plugin is going to be your implementation of the brilliant ideas that you have. This Fancy IntelliJ Platform Plugin is going to be your implementation of the brilliant ideas that you have.

View File

@ -141,6 +141,7 @@ jobs:
uses: codecov/codecov-action@v5 uses: codecov/codecov-action@v5
with: with:
files: ${{ github.workspace }}/build/reports/kover/report.xml files: ${{ github.workspace }}/build/reports/kover/report.xml
token: ${{ secrets.CODECOV_TOKEN }}
# Run Qodana inspections and provide a report # Run Qodana inspections and provide a report
inspectCode: inspectCode:

View File

@ -27,6 +27,7 @@
- Dependencies (GitHub Actions) - upgrade `jlumbroso/free-disk-space` to `v1.3.1` - Dependencies (GitHub Actions) - upgrade `jlumbroso/free-disk-space` to `v1.3.1`
- Gradle - upgrade `org.gradle.toolchains.foojay-resolver-convention` to `1.0.0` - Gradle - upgrade `org.gradle.toolchains.foojay-resolver-convention` to `1.0.0`
- Change since build to `243` (2024.3) - Change since build to `243` (2024.3)
- Update codecov configuration based on new required upload token
## [2.1.0] - 2025-03-28 ## [2.1.0] - 2025-03-28

10
codecov.yml Normal file
View File

@ -0,0 +1,10 @@
coverage:
status:
project:
default:
informational: true
threshold: 0%
base: auto
patch:
default:
informational: true